PT Natura City Developments Tbk

Symbol: CITY.JK

JKT

50

IDR

Market price today

  • 134.5856

    P/E Ratio

  • -5.5227

    PEG Ratio

  • 270.26B

    MRK Cap

  • 0.00%

    DIV Yield

PT Natura City Developments Tbk Competitors List